      <Abstract>Aim: To assess child personality attributes using Pictorial Personality Traits Questionnaire Children (PPTQ-C) for prediction of child behavior at the first dental visit and its co-relation with the Frankl behavior rating scale.&#13;
&#13;
Methodology: A sample size of 110 children between the ages 6-9 years requiring preventive treatment was included and they were asked to fill out the PPTQ-C before the treatment. The personality trait was evaluated. The Frankl behavior rating of the subjects was noted at the time of the treatment. A correlation was established between the personality trait and Frankl behavior rating scale. The Pearson correlation test was used to obtain a correlation between the Frankl behavior rating scale and the personality traits.&#13;
&#13;
Results: A positive correlation was found between the trait of Extraversion and a negative correlation between Neuroticism and the Frankl behavior rating scale.&#13;
&#13;
Conclusion: The PPTQ-C can be used to assess child personality attributes for the prediction of child behavior at the first dental visit. However, the findings are preliminary and need to be validated with bigger sample sizes across varied groups.</Abstract>
